Aug 17, 2023SteeringElectrical system

My 2023 Nautilus is currently at the dealership I purchased from.Shults Lincoln. Steering column, tilt and telescopic adjustments. While driving vehicle the tilt and telescopic moves on its on. This has happened mulitudes of times. The most danderous event occured while my wife was driving and the telescopic feature pinned my wife in the seat. She had no control of steering the vehicle when the this happened. She was in a S turn and it could of been a bad accident, thank God there was no oncoming traffic. She had no control of steering when it telescoped all the way out. She came ever so close of rolling the vehicle. Yesterday 8/16/2023 it happened at the dealership with the salesman and service manager driving the vehicle. This was at the dealership where I purchsed. On 8/14/23 it had a new top steering column cover replaced at Family Ford/Lincoln dealership. They are in Marietta Ohio. I purchased at Shults Lincoln in Wexford PA.. There is no warning lights or caution before this steering column moves on its own. This has been going on sine July 20, 2023. Within the last week the battery has drained completely on 3 different times. 1500 miles registered and I had to jump start the vehicle. Shults Lincoln picked up the vehicle yesterday. This problem is going to get someone seriouly hurt. Its happened well over a dozen times. Its done it twice in one drive.
